Sari Restaurant is a Indonesia company, located in Jl MH Thamrin 71 B-71 C; PADANG; 00000; SUMATERA BARAT. more detail is as below.
- Log in to post comments
Sari Restaurant is a Indonesia company, located in Jl MH Thamrin 71 B-71 C; PADANG; 00000; SUMATERA BARAT. more detail is as below.